Metal siding services involve the installation, replacement, or repair of metal panels on the exterior of a property. This type of service typically includes assessing the existing siding, removing damaged or outdated materials, and carefully installing durable metal panels that can enhance the building’s appearance and structural integrity. Local contractors may also offer customizations such as color matching or specific panel styles to better suit the design preferences of homeowners. Metal siding is known for its long-lasting qualities and ability to withstand harsh weather conditions, making it a popular choice for those seeking a resilient exterior surface.
This service helps address several common problems faced by property owners. For example, metal siding can effectively resolve issues related to rotting or warping of traditional wood siding, which can lead to costly repairs and maintenance. It also provides a solution for properties suffering from frequent pest infestations or moisture penetration, as metal panels are resistant to pests and do not absorb water. Additionally, metal siding can improve energy efficiency by providing better insulation, which can help reduce heating and cooling costs over time. When exterior surfaces become damaged, faded, or outdated, metal siding offers a practical upgrade that can significantly enhance curb appeal and property value.
Properties that often utilize metal siding services include residential homes, especially those in areas prone to severe weather, as well as commercial buildings, warehouses, and industrial facilities. The overview below groups typical Metal Siding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or siding repairs, such as patching or replacing a few panels, typ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ine repair jobs fall within this range, though costs can vary based on material and extent of damage.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of siding or upgrading specific areas usually ranges from $1,000 to $3,000. Larger, more complex partial projects tend to push costs toward the higher end of this spectrum.
Full Siding Replacement - Complete siding installation for an average-sized home generally costs between $5,000 and $15,000. Many projects land in the middle of this range, but larger or more intricate jobs can exceed $20,000.
Material and Design Choices - Costs can vary significantly depending on the siding material and design preferences, with premium options like steel or specialty finishes often increasing the total.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ates based on specific project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of metal siding for a home? Metal siding offers durability, low maintenance, and resistance to pests and weather, making it a popular choice for many homeowners.

What types of metal siding are available? Local contractors typically offer various options such as aluminum, steel, and copper siding, allowing customization based on style and durability preferences.
Can metal siding be installed on existing structures? Yes, many service providers can install metal siding over existing siding or as part of a renovation project, depending on the home's condition.
What maintenance is required for metal siding? Metal siding generally requires minimal maintenance, usually involving periodic cleaning to keep it looking its best and to prevent buildup of dirt or debris.
